So I think I just discovered a glitch, the red dragon on the bridge can apparently be killed with one single arrow, and thus earning me 10.000 easy free souls. I'm actually kind of bummed I did this, because this game is mostly about challenge and amazing boss fights, and doing something like this removed some of that aspect. But if you'd like to know how, just after you kill the 3 rats underneath the bridge, climb up the ladder and continue up the stairs, there should be a knight there, after you've killed him, just find a place where you can see the dragon, then shoot him, boom, he dies. Be sure to get the Drake Sword first if you want that.

Game » consists of 14 releases. Released Sep 22, 2011
A quasi-sequel to From Software's action-RPG Demon's Souls, set in a new universe while retaining most of the basic gameplay and the high level of challenge. It features a less-linear world, a new checkpoint system in the form of bonfires, and the unique Humanity system.

Yep, dunno when, but they fixed some of the glitchier ways to kill old Bridgey. They prevented you from shooting him from the tower and are also preventing you from shooting him hella full of arrows in a safe, cheap fashion, since his health eventually stops dropping around the 2/3 full mark (well, he's actually healing himself). Looks like I'm going to get incinerated a few times if I want to drop that thing.

@Darkstar614: you can actually defeat him quite early on if you use Gold Pine Resin on a spear or any weapon you have, you just need to get him to drop down and get behind him, he has a hard time turning around.
i saw a guy doing a speedrun of the game and he killed the dragon legit using a handaxe in 2 hands, pretty impressive stuff
@Darkstar614: no .. you can fight him on the bridge and he has some close range attack patterns .. but its out of the league of a normal character to kill it like that till much later ..
just like in demons souls , it serves as a large trap feature , you can kill it for extra bonuses , but its not considered a "boss"
@StingerMK2: that guy just chops the tail off and gets the drake sword that way , he doesnt KILL the dragon
